Arctic Fox, long ago had a white coat all the time, all year long.
Life is easy for a fox. Hunting is easy when you are white like the snow and you can hide from rabbits and birds and other tasty treats. And even when the tundra is green, fox is a clever little animal. No one can outsmart fox.

Fox, on a fine summer day, saw a molting goose nesting and eating bv a lake, all her feathers gone. Fox crept over, surprising the goose with, "Mmm, goose is good. Good to eat. You don"t have your feathers on. No flying for you, so I'm going to eat you!"
Goose did not move, not a bill, not a web on a foot. And after a little thought, the goose said, "True, I can't run fast enough, and I can't fly without my feathers on, and you will surely eat me. But before you do, one last wish?"
"A wiley one he is." Fox thought. "Well you didn't run away. What might you say, what might you wish?", said Fox.
Goose begged, "Sing! Sing for me! It is told far and wide, your voice is very fine!"
